ledofthezep Posted June 18, 2005 Report Posted June 18, 2005 If I'm understanding this...you theres a plug wire that doesn't allow whichever cyl it's on to fire? If that's the case, you may unscrew the cap, clip the wire a snatch hair & rescrew it on to make sure it's got a good connection, asside from that, If you're still having the same issues, I'd say probably coil. If it's the stator it'll most likely be firing, but backfiring, or nothing at all on either cyl...most likely similar symptoms if it's the cdi, probably no spark at all though.
